Yes. If you mean litigation support for attorneys handling medical-malpractice cases—rather than a law firm itself—there are several firms worth considering.
MedMal Consulting — Particularly focused on medical malpractice. It offers physician case reviews, medical-record screening, chronologies, expert-witness referrals, discovery/deposition support, and trial consulting. It specifically says it works with plaintiff attorneys nationwide.
Juris-Med Legal — A broader medical-legal litigation-support company offering medical-record summaries, chronologies, deposition summaries, medical-literature research, missing-record identification, and expert-witness searches. Its reviewers include U.S.-based physicians and healthcare professionals.
Physicians Medical Review (PMR) — Physician- and attorney-owned, with more than 15 years in medicolegal consulting. It handles medical-malpractice consulting, medical-expert referrals, and complex medical-record/case evaluation.
Med League — Has provided medical expert-witness and malpractice litigation support since 1989, including expert referrals, medical-record review, pain-and-suffering reports, and life-care planning.
Trivent Legal — Offers an end-to-end litigation-support platform specifically covering personal injury, medical malpractice, and mass-tort cases, including medical-record analysis and case evaluation.
My first calls would be MedMal Consulting or Physicians Medical Review if your priority is actual medical-malpractice case analysis and expert support, rather than simply outsourcing medical-record summarization.

If you mean litigation support for attorneys handling medical-malpractice cases—medical-record review, chronologies, standard-of-care analysis, expert identification, deposition/trial support, etc.—there are several good options in Arizona and nationwide.
Medmal Consultants — Fountain Hills, AZ. This is probably the closest match to your description: its focus is specifically medical and dental malpractice consulting, including case review, research, and standards-of-practice issues.
Ana Legal Nurse / Scorpio Legal Nurse — Phoenix, AZ. Provides medical-legal consulting with an emphasis on medically complex cases, record review, case evaluation, and translating clinical information into litigation strategy.
Injury Reporting Consultants, LLC — Phoenix, AZ. More comprehensive medico-legal support, including formal reports and analysis for medical malpractice, personal injury, and damages disputes.
Garcia MedLegal Consulting — Chandler/Phoenix area. It specifically provides medical litigation support, medical-record analysis, case evaluation, chronologies and summaries, and says it serves Arizona as well as clients nationwide.
ARK Legal Nurse Consulting — nationwide. Particularly worth considering if you need malpractice case screening, medical-record/policy review, causation analysis, chronologies, medical literature research, and expert-witness identification.
A.C.E. Legal Nurse Consulting — nationwide. Offers medical-record review, case-merit screening, standard-of-care research, expert coordination, deposition and trial support, and specifically lists medical malpractice as a practice area.
Med League Expert Witnesses and Consulting — nationwide. An established medical litigation-support organization that says it has assisted attorneys with the medical aspects of malpractice and personal-injury cases since 1989.
If this is for an Arizona medical-malpractice matter, I'd start with Medmal Consultants, Garcia MedLegal, and ARK Legal Nurse Consulting. They appear particularly aligned with the medical-malpractice/litigation-support niche rather than being general personal-injury support providers.
